The Role of Custom Made Bolts in Modern Industry
Custom made bolts play a vital role across industries where standard fasteners cannot meet specific requirements. Unlike off-the-shelf options, these bolts are designed to match unique dimensions, materials, and strength levels demanded by specialized applications. From heavy machinery to aerospace engineering, they ensure performance, reliability, and safety under challenging conditions. Their adaptability makes them indispensable in sectors where precision engineering is not optional but mandatory.
Tailored Design for Specific Applications
One of the greatest advantages of a custom made bolt is its ability to meet exact project specifications. Engineers often require non-standard diameters, lengths, or threading patterns that regular bolts cannot provide. By working with manufacturers, businesses can request bolts engineered to precise tolerances and made from chosen alloys. This tailored approach ensures not only a perfect fit but also extended durability, which directly impacts the efficiency of the machines and structures they hold together.
Materials and Strength Considerations
The choice of material in a custom made bolt is crucial for performance. Depending on the environment, bolts may need to resist corrosion, endure high pressure, or withstand extreme temperatures. Stainless steel, titanium, and specialized alloys are commonly used to achieve these goals. Additionally, heat treatment and surface coatings can further enhance strength and longevity. By selecting the right material composition, manufacturers create bolts capable of excelling in even the harshest operational environments.
Industries Benefiting from Custom Solutions
Custom made bolts find applications across diverse industries. In construction, they provide secure fastening for structural frameworks. In automotive and aerospace sectors, they meet strict standards for safety and performance. Oil and gas companies rely on them to endure corrosive marine conditions, while energy sectors demand them for turbine assembly and wind energy structures. Each industry benefits from the assurance that custom fasteners deliver—engineered precision and reliable strength where failure is not an option.
Advancements in Manufacturing Technology
Modern manufacturing methods have revolutionized the production of custom made bolts. With the integration of CNC machining, 3D modeling, and advanced metallurgy, manufacturers now produce fasteners with unmatched accuracy. These technologies allow rapid prototyping and mass customization while maintaining strict quality control. Such innovations reduce lead times and ensure consistent results, offering industries a reliable supply of bolts that match their evolving requirements. The synergy of technology and engineering has raised the standard for custom fastener production worldwide.
